In an automatic transmission, the fluid acts as a hydraulic medium, transferring power from the engine to the gearbox, and it also contains specialized additives that facilitate smooth clutch engagement and braking within the torque converter.

If the level is low, the pump can draw in air, leading to a condition known as cavitation, which causes erratic shifting, increased wear, and potential catastrophic failure. While modern transmissions are designed to be largely maintenance-free, verifying the fluid level remains a critical step in ensuring smooth gear shifts, preventing overheating, and extending the lifespan of this complex mechanical system.

Locating the Transmission Fluid Dipstick For the majority of automatic vehicles, the transmission fluid can be checked using a dipstick, similar to the one for the engine oil. Unlike engine oil, which has a dipstick in most cases, transmission fluid assessment requires a specific procedure that varies between automatic and manual systems, making it essential to understand the correct method for your specific vehicle.
